Bed Linen Types: What’s Included in Bed Linen?
Bed linen isn't a one-size-fits-all term. It's a collection of essential components, each playing a vital role in your comfort and the overall look of your bed. Here's a breakdown of what's typically included:

-
Bed Sheets: The foundation of your bed linen, bed sheets usually come in a set:
-
Fitted Sheet: Designed with elasticized corners, this sheet fits snugly over your mattress, protecting it and providing a smooth surface to lie on.
-
Flat Sheet (or Top Sheet): Placed over the fitted sheet, this acts as a light covering between you and your duvet or blanket.
-
Pillowcases/Pillow Shams: These covers protect your pillows and contribute to the bed's aesthetic. Pillowcases are simpler, while shams often have decorative flanges and are used for display during the day.
-
Duvet Covers: A duvet cover is essentially a protective, decorative sleeve for your duvet insert (a soft, flat bag filled with down, feathers, or synthetic fibers). They are easy to remove and wash, allowing for versatility in your bedding style.
-
Duvets: While often confused with comforters, a duvet insert is typically a plain, white insert that requires a duvet cover. They provide warmth without the need for multiple layers of blankets.
-
Comforters: Similar to duvets, comforters are also filled with insulating materials but are usually designed to be used without an additional cover, often featuring decorative stitching or patterns.
-
Blankets: An additional layer for warmth or decoration, blankets come in various materials and weights.
-
Quilts: Traditionally made of three layers, a woven cloth top, a layer of batting or wadding, and a woven back, combined using quilting, quilts can be both decorative and functional for warmth.
-
Mattress Pads: A layer of padding placed on top of the mattress, a mattress pad, especially a waterproof mattress pad, adds an extra layer of comfort and protection, extending the life of your mattress.

-
Mattress Encasements: Mattress encasement fully encase your mattress, providing comprehensive protection against allergens, dust mites, spills, and bed bugs.
-
Pillows: While not strictly "linen," pillows are an integral part of bed setup, providing head and neck support.

Bed Linen Sizes
Selecting the correct size bed linen is crucial for a neat appearance and comfortable fit. Sizes generally correspond to standard mattress dimensions:
-
Twin: For single beds, typically 38" x 75".
-
Twin XL: Longer than a twin, often found in dorm rooms, 38" x 80".
-
Full (or Double): Wider than a twin, 54" x 75".
-
Queen: A popular choice for couples, 60" x 80".
-
King: Offers ample space, 76" x 80".
-
California King: Narrower but longer than a King, 72" x 84".
Always double-check the dimensions of your mattress before purchasing bed linen to ensure a perfect fit.
Common Fabrics In Bed Linen
The fabric of your bed linen significantly impacts its feel, breathability, durability, and how well it drapes. Here are some of the most common options:

-
Cotton: The most popular choice, known for its softness, breathability, and durability.
-
Egyptian Cotton: Renowned for its long fibers, resulting in incredibly soft, strong, and lustrous sheets.
-
Pima Cotton/Supima Cotton: Another high-quality cotton with long fibers, offering excellent softness and strength.
-
Percale: A crisp, matte weave with a cool feel, often associated with hotel sheets.
-
Sateen: A weave that gives cotton a smooth, slightly lustrous finish, often feeling very soft.
-
Flannel: Brushed cotton that creates a soft, fuzzy surface, perfect for warmth in colder climates.
-
Linen: Made from flax fibers, linen is highly breathable, absorbent, and durable. It has a distinctive, relaxed, slightly wrinkled look and gets softer with each wash.
-
Microfiber: A synthetic fabric made from finely woven fibers (usually polyester). It's very soft, wrinkle-resistant, and often more affordable.
-
Bamboo: A sustainable option, bamboo fabric is incredibly soft, naturally hypoallergenic, and known for its excellent temperature-regulating properties.
-
Silk: Luxurious and smooth, silk is naturally hypoallergenic and excellent for sensitive skin and hair. It's also a natural temperature regulator.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)
Here are some common questions people ask about bed linen:
-
What is the best thread count for sheets?
While a higher thread count often indicates a finer, softer fabric, it's not the only factor. A good quality cotton sheet with a thread count between 200 and 400 can be excellent. Anything excessively high might not genuinely reflect quality and could be misleading.
-
How often should I change my bed linen?
It's generally recommended to change your bed linen once a week, or more frequently if you sweat a lot, have allergies, or share your bed with pets.
-
What's the difference between a duvet and a comforter?
A duvet is typically a plain, white insert that requires a decorative duvet cover, which is easily washable. A comforter is usually decorative on its own and does not require an additional cover, making it harder to wash.
-
How do I care for my bed linen?
Always check the care label on your specific items. Generally, most cotton bed linen can be machine-washed in warm water with a gentle detergent and tumble-dried on low. Avoid harsh chemicals and excessive heat, which can damage fibers.
-
Are mattress pads and mattress encasements the same?
No. A mattress pad adds an extra layer of cushioning and some protection from minor spills. A mattress encasement fully zips around your entire mattress, providing comprehensive protection against allergens, dust mites, bed bugs, and spills, making it an excellent investment for hygiene and mattress longevity.
